How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Theatre District?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Theatre District Studio Apartments | $1,530 | $564 | $2,925 |
Theatre District 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,930 | $589 | $3,143 |
Theatre District 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,479 | $589 | $3,750 |
Theatre District 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,918 | $1,779 | $3,507 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Theatre District
How much are Studio apartments in Theatre District?
There are currently 81 Studio Apartments in Theatre District with rent ranges from $564 to $2,925 with an average price of $1,530.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Theatre District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Theatre District ranges from $589 to $3,143 with an average monthly rent of $1,930.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Theatre District c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Theatre District range from $589 to $3,750.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,479.
How expensive are Theatre District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 31 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Theatre District on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,779 to $3,507 - averaging $2,918 for the location.
